Examples of Expert Systems
- MYCIN: It was based on backward chaining and could identify various bacteria that could cause acute infections.
- DENDRAL: Expert system used for chemical analysis to predict molecular structure.
- PXDES: An Example of Expert System used to predict the degree and type of lung cancer.
What is meant by expert systems?
An expert system is a computer program that uses artificial intelligence (AI) technologies to simulate the judgment and behavior of a human or an organization that has expert knowledge and experience in a particular field.

What is the role of expert system?
In artificial intelligence, an expert system is a computer system emulating the decision-making ability of a human expert. Expert systems are designed to solve complex problems by reasoning through bodies of knowledge, represented mainly as if–then rules rather than through conventional procedural code.

Why do expert systems fail?
However, they may also fail because the problem they are dealing with is not or cannot be understood, because they require common sense or knowledge of the limitations of their knowledge, because they cannot be tested, or because they cannot or will not be trusted.
